Florida Man Accused of Assaulting Wife's Lover with Baseball Bat

A Florida man, John Dimmig, 33, is facing attempted murder charges after allegedly attacking his wife's coworker with a baseball bat. The incident occurred on June 17th at a Lake Worth Beach Airbnb, where Dimmig allegedly discovered his wife, Christie Barbato, with another man.

According to police reports and surveillance footage, Dimmig entered the Airbnb and confronted the man, striking him multiple times with a metal baseball bat. Barbato's pleas and intervention reportedly stopped the assault. The victim, a CT technologist visiting from Arizona, sustained significant head injuries and stated he believed Dimmig intended to kill him.

Upon arrival, police found the injured man and subsequently interviewed both Barbato and Dimmig. Dimmig denied involvement, claiming he hadn't left his home except for a grocery store trip. However, police found evidence contradicting his alibi, including a bat with hair embedded in it, potentially blood-stained clothing, and traffic camera footage placing his vehicle near the Airbnb shortly before the attack.

Dimmig has been charged with attempted murder, aggravated battery with a deadly weapon, and burglary with battery. He has pleaded not guilty and is awaiting his next court appearance. Barbato, also a CT technologist, reportedly met the victim for drinks earlier that evening before going to the Airbnb. Attempts to reach both Dimmig and Barbato for comment have been unsuccessful.
